Sourcing systems an aid not a solution, say Clever Lending

Despite growing use of automated sourcing systems for second charge mortgages, master broker Clever Lending argues new technology cannot replace the conventional lending decision process.

While new technologies narrow down potential options in a rapidly changing market environment, the personal touch is necessary to carry out more complex assessments of clients’ circumstances.

Sam Kirtikar, managing director of Clever Lending, said: “Investing in sourcing systems is clearly a good use of technical spend as it allows master brokers to provide introducers access to their lender panel products via a slick sourcing system and streamlined advised or packaged processes that will help product choice and underwriting during the application process. With that comes the added benefit of increasing awareness of second charges which many brokers and their clients may not have really considered before.

“But each case is unique and more often than not there are factors that a system cannot pick up or be flexible towards. Sourcing systems are a very useful tool to increase and illustrate affordable options and when this speed of comparison is backed up by a qualified underwriter we can move towards the goal of providing the most appropriate solution for the client. When launching our own Clever Sourcing system with Mortgage27tech, we ensured that it was always backed up with resource to handle case specifics and with hundreds of brokers already using the system it’s clear that brokers still want a quality, personal service when dealing with important client financial decisions.”

Clever Lending are a second charge, commercial and bridging master broker and are part of the Totemic Group.
